Tuberous Sclerosis Complex with Lymphangioleiomyomatosis (LAM) and Multifocal Micronodular Pneumocyte Hyperplasia (MMPH)

Imaging findings
CT of the chest in a 34-year-old female reveals a right-sided pneumothorax treated with a chest tube, alongside numerous, uniformly distributed, thin-walled lung cysts characteristic of lymphangioleiomyomatosis. Additionally, there are scattered small, ground-glass nodules representing multifocal micronodular pneumocyte hyperplasia, myocardial fatty foci, and multiple low-attenuation renal angiomyolipomas.
Key takeaways
Lymphangioleiomyomatosis is a progressive cystic lung disease that can present with spontaneous pneumothorax and is frequently associated with tuberous sclerosis complex. Key ancillary findings of tuberous sclerosis on chest CT include multifocal micronodular pneumocyte hyperplasia, myocardial fatty foci, and renal angiomyolipomas.
